Micropiles are small-diameter, drilled and grouted foundation elements, typically 5 to 12 inches across, reinforced with a steel bar or pipe casing and installed to depths of 50 feet or more. Instead of spreading load across a shallow footing, a micropile carries it to a deeper, confirmed bearing layer, whether that's dense soil, rock, or a zone verified clear of karst voids.
In San Antonio, that verification step matters more than in most cities, since Edwards Limestone karst and Blackland clay shrink-swell can occur within feet of each other along the Balcones Fault Zone. Because micropile rigs are compact, they can also work on tight lots near downtown and the medical center where larger foundation equipment can't maneuver. Helical piers work well in soft soil but can lose reliable capacity in the area's hard limestone or where karst voids interrupt the bearing layer. Micropiles are drilled rather than screwed in, allowing verification of the bearing zone before load is applied.
We drill test borings to confirm the bearing zone is free of voids before finalizing pile depth, rather than assuming the Edwards Limestone beneath a site is solid throughout.
Micropile drilling generates minimal vibration and a small volume of spoils compared to driven piling, making it a common choice for additions close to an existing foundation.
